1

因为我正在学习如何使用 Heroku 和在 Rails 上编码,所以我想问一下我遇到的这个奇怪的问题

我正在使用 Heroku 将我的 Rails 应用程序在线推送并使用postgresql作为我的数据库。我已经通过命令成功推送了我的代码

git push heroku master
然而,即使我已经在我的模型中添加了存在验证,并且即使它可以在线工作,我仍然无法让它在 Heroku 上工作。我的型号代码;

class User < ActiveRecord::Base
  attr_accessible :name
  validates :name, :presence => true 
end

如果我能得到一些想法,我将不胜感激。我希望它与部署无关,因为它可以在线正常工作。

4

1 回答 1

1

您可以通过执行git diff heroku/master. 如果您已正确提交和部署所有内容,则应该不会显示任何更改。

于 2012-09-07T14:01:15.500 回答